Detailed Notes on monkey

You might also listen to the term “primate” employed for monkeys and apes. Primate is definitely the scientific title to the get that all monkeys and apes belong to. Primates also contain animals like lemurs, bush infants and sluggish lorises – the latter two are sometimes nocturnal and largely tree-dwelling, fruit-feeding on and vast-eyed cr

read more